The CLARITY Act, aimed at providing regulatory certainty for stablecoins, faces an unexpected hurdle: former President Donald Trump's burgeoning crypto business. Despite bipartisan momentum in both the House and Senate, the bill has stalled as lawmakers grapple with potential conflicts of interest arising from Trump's crypto ventures, including his NFT collections and memecoin. This political entanglement complicates efforts to establish clear stablecoin regulations, which are crucial for broader crypto market adoption and stability. The delay underscores how political dynamics and individual interests can impede essential legislative progress for the digital asset space. What to watch next is whether lawmakers can navigate this ethical dilemma to advance stablecoin legislation.
